Barnacle Rock is a small islet located in the Na h-Eileanan Siar archipelago, an area with a rich Gaelic heritage and historical ties to Norse and early Christian settlements. While no permanent population is recorded, such rocky islets were often used for seasonal grazing or as landmarks in traditional seafaring routes.
